Gate-way opens for 'Experts City'
Transforming former 'Tripoli Market' to an eye catching 'Experts City', Colombo welcomes one of the new world order into the city designing a unique setting for inventors while encouraging them for new innovations, creations, inventions and discoveries.
The new 'Experts City' going be an exclusive setting where all think-tanks, including scientific, technical and mechanical inventors and experts could assemble under one roof and brainstorm to invent novel products.
Secretary Defence and Urban Development Gotabaya Rajapaksa declared opened one of the renovated buildings namely' CODEGEN' on Monday (28). It's a company which has been established to perform research creating new strides in the field of electronics while going to the extent of experiments with electric mobility.
